Leigh Bursey and Project Mantra have been performing across southeastern Ontario and other parts of Canada for well over a decade. The folk/punk/hip hop/spoken word/alternative rock foursome will grace the stage for the first time at the Gladstone Theatre this Saturday, playing a mix of old and new material from their retrospective catalogue, this will make their first performance as a foursome since March 2020 in Kingston.
Leigh Bursey is 34 year old international best-selling author, residing in Brockville, Ontario, Canada. A community organizer, a published poet, children’s author, rock music journalist, motivational speaker, and editorialist, Leigh is also a cable access television talk show host, and a mental health advocate. Leigh is also a former homeless youth and a current municipal councillor.
The band featuring Mike “Just Mic” Paquin (bass and backing vocals), Morgan O’Dell (drums), and recent addition Connery Brown (lead guitars) has released three full length albums and is currently signed to Bursey’s label Recovery Records.
The group has been featured on CBC Radio, Global Television, Yes FM out of Ogdensburg, New York, and on Live 88.5FM here in Ottawa.
